The bearing 6003-2Z is a standard piece, but in karting, the choice of quality is decisive. Its dimensions of 17mm (interior) x 35mm (exterior) x 10mm (width) make it the standard for many applications on steering rockets and wheel hubs.
Suffix "2z" means that it is equipped with two metal flanges of protection. This is crucial: it prevents track dust and gum splashes to get inside while keeping the factory grease. A bearing that "scratches" or is seized, it is immediately a peak loss and a kart that becomes imprecise in the front train.
Reduction of friction: A precision bearing turns more freely, which releases valuable horses out of turn.
Waterproofing "2z": The metal flanges effectively protect the balls against dirt without adding the friction of a rubber seal (heavier and more braking).
Increased durability: Made with high strength steels, they support the lateral stresses (turns pressed) much better than low-end DIY bearings.
Dimensional precision: A perfect fit on your 17mm axis avoids the game in the direction or in the wheels, ensuring a rigorous front train.

| Feature | Specification |
| Type | 6003-2z |
| Inner diameter (d) | 17 mm |
| Outside diameter (d) | 35 mm |
| Width (B) | 10 mm |
| Seal | 2 metal flanges (2z) |
| Application | Rockets, hubs, front train |
Q: Can I ride a 6003 bearing without the "2z" ?
A: The open turn (unprotected) is to be proscribed absolutely in karting because of dust and gravel. You must always use a 2Z model (double metal protection) or 2RS (double rubber protection).
Q: What is the difference with a 2RS bearing ?
A: The 2RS has rubber seals that are totally waterproof, but they create a little more friction than a 2z metal. The 2z is the ideal compromise standard in karting for pure speed.
